Coriander in Redwood

This high ceiling restaurant called ‘Coriander in Redwood’ has its long history of over 80 years. The eatery was modified from an old house made entirely of redwood and originally owned by a Thai local. It was once used as an office and residence of Englishmen when they obtained teak concessions in Thailand and when their logs were floated down the Yuam River to join the Salawin River, continuing their journey on through Burma.

To preserve and give a new life to the old building, of which the structure and the timber quality is still perfect, we have modified the house’s ground floor as a restaurant, while the upstairs is now used as a function room (in partnership with Riverhouse Resort).

The restaurant opens daily and boasts the capacity to host up to 150 pax, serving wine and catering Thai dishes as well as steaks for lunch and dinner.
